    This logline does not give us a glimpse of story.

    Here would be an example of a logline structure:

    “When (This happens) an (Adjective) flight attendant must (Do this) if he is to (Accomplish this) but (This bad thing) will happen if he fails.”

    There are of course other variations, but this would be a good example of logline structure.

    A lead character needs a goal and something standing in the way of the goal.? Adding that element to this logline will help.

    Also, it is good to give us a brief 2 or 3 word description of the lead character. something beyond just ‘she’ would also
    help this logline.
